Yeah. I noticed the Anglo perspective, but in the case of my civ I decided to ignore it. (Irish cities in English names is somewhat of a political thing...)Martinus said:Gdansk. Boxer-briefs.
Seriously, the jury is still out on the language convention. The vanilla civ seems to be following the line of English names (so there is Rome, not Roma; and Peter not Pyotr) and in most cases the English names of those Polish cities are the same as German names. I will probably release two versions in the end, one with English/German names (Casimir, John, Warsaw, Thorn, Danzig) and one with Polish names (Kazimierz, Jan, Warszawa, Torun, Gdansk).
